Transaction 5f3815eb103b1f1712762550b5f4db583185d63690136d980c87bd6581290a36
1 Input
1 Output
-
5f3815eb103b1f1712762550b5f4db583185d63690136d980c87bd6581290a36:0
- value
- 2331093
- script pubkey
- OP_0 OP_PUSHBYTES_20 694189c53d9d85103f4223b70fc1a48a04a7f4aa
- address
- bc1qd9qcn3fankz3q06zywmslsdy3gz20a92hrzg39